Monthly budget at $75K โ Vilnius vs Santa Rosa
| Expense | Vilnius | Santa Rosa |
|---|---|---|
| Monthly take-home | $3,491 | $4,159 |
| 1BR rent | $800 | $2,200 |
| Groceries | $380 | $410 |
| Transport | $150 | $72 |
| Utilities | $95 | $148 |
| Internet | $28 | $68 |
| Left after essentials | $2,038 | $1,261 |

Is Santa Rosa cheaper than Vilnius?
No. Santa Rosa has a cost of living index of 140 vs 60 for Vilnius (100 = US average). That's about 133% more expensive.
How much will I save moving from Vilnius to Santa Rosa?
On a $75K salary, core expenses in Santa Rosa run about $731/month more than Vilnius. Factor this into your salary negotiation when relocating.
What salary do I need in Santa Rosa to match my Vilnius lifestyle?
To maintain the same purchasing power as $75,000 in Vilnius, you'd need roughly $175,000/year in Santa Rosa. This is based on the overall COL index difference.
